Optimal Product Mix
The combination of products that maximizes profit or utility under specific constraints and market conditions.
Linear Programming
A mathematical method used to find the best possible outcome in a given mathematical model with linear relationships.
Investment Portfolio
A collection of stocks, bonds, or other investment vehicles chosen by an individual or institution to achieve specific financial goals.
Objective Function
A mathematical function used in optimization to define the goal of the optimization problem, typically involving the maximization or minimization of some quantity.
